    I was just vote-kicked in under 1 second after a vote came up after spending the past 20 minutes help push the team forward. This was on the euro server. There's a lot wrong with this:

    - how can a vote go forward in under 1 second? Did a bunch of people seriously see the vote and just knee-jerk it? I mean, I barely even saw the message and the red-circle around my guy before I was kicked. Seriously?

    - I play the game regularly and have done so for at least a month. I've played several rounds this weekend, each time I've been at the top, or near the top of the score list. There should be some kind of kick immunity for people that are obviously playing for real. Persistent reputation or something... It's just lame to be rocking it for your team and then some juvenile ass-hat raises a vote and you're gone. Game-breaker.

    Knee jerk voting is definitely an issue. When I vote kick greifers I rarely even type in a legit reason anymore - more like "Snoopicus finds this man's smell offensive" or something. He gets kicked in a second or less.

    People often ask me what he did AFTER the vote. Too late for the greifer obviously.

    I think the speed at which people votekick is the natural result of people knowing how fast a greifer can tear down a fort. We know that they need to be booted NOW or the tower is gonna collapse.

    Honestly, despite some of the issues, I'd rather have a few innocent victims than let the greifers roam free. Perhaps people who have been marked as greifer by others cannot initiate vote kicks? This might prevent unscrupulous individuals from greif by votekicking.
